#c0fbbf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c0fbbf is composed of 75.3% red, 98.4%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.9%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 119 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 86.7%. #c0fbbf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#81f77f.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#c0fbbf color description : Very soft lime green.

#c0fbbf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c0fbbf has RGB values of R:192, G:251,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 12647359.

Shades and Tints of #c0fbbf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a01 is the darkest color, while #f7fef6 is the lightest one.
